Powers/Abilities
His Kherubim heritage enables him to project whips made of psychic energy from his hands. Backlash can turn himself (and his costume) into mist, which also acts as a limited healing factor. Most injuries sustained in battle will heal after he solidifies (however, the recent loss of his leg has yet to be healed and was replaced with a hydraulic limb). Additionally, his long history in various military services has given him expert hand-to-hand combat skills as well as a proficiency in weapons and tactics. Due to his Kherubim heritage, Backlash is extremely long lived.

Bio:
WildStorm's Immortal Warrior Marc Slayton was born in Atlantis, the son of a human mother and Lord S'lyton, an enhanced Kherubim Lord. When his father sacrificed his life to imprison one-time allies the D'rahn, a race of hostile aliens whose attack led to the sinking of Atlantis, young Marc was spirited away by Ferrian, his father's former advisor. Ferrian raised the child to adulthood, tutoring him in fighting skills for his protection. Once Marc was old enough to look after himself Ferrian dropped out of sight and left him to fend for himself.

Marc spent the next three thousand years traveling around the world, living a life of adventure. He has only fragmented memories of his long life. At one point he was a ninja, at another he was a medieval knight.

Team Zero
In World War II, he was recruited for a mission to be led by that era's Deathblow as an intelligence specialist for a secret strike force known as Team Zero. Sadly, Team Zero was destroyed and Slayton disappeared.

Team One
In the 1960's Backlash was an Air Force Colonel, working as part of the extra-terrestrial threats squad Team One, a government team designed to combat extra-terrestrial threats to the United States.

Team 7
Later, using the codename Backlash, he joined Team 7, a special ops unit which was deliberately exposed to a mutagenic chemical called the Gen-Factor. All of the members developed superhuman powers - in Marc's case some of these were the result of his alien heritage being fully activated. Team 7 finished their final mission and then went A.W.O.L., but Marc made a deal with with I.O.'s Director Miles Craven to guarantee the safe flight of Team 7 and their children in return for for the unquestioned loyalty of John Lynch, Michael Cray and himself. Craven agreed, though he secretly continued his hunt for Gen-Actives.

StormWatch
Backlash was assigned to join and spy on StormWatch, the U.N.'s Crisis Intervention superteam. He worked as the group's field leader and instructor until he lost several members of the first team (later dubbed Stormwatch Prime) during a mission in Kuwait, after which he switched to being the full time instructor. When a Daemonite called S'Yrn put Marc's girlfriend, Major Diane LaSalle into a coma, he deserted StormWatch to track her down, breaking a Cabal agent, Taboo, out of prison to help him on his quest. While he eventually caught his prey and revived Diane, he and Taboo had become lovers, and both had become fugitives.

Department P.S.I.
Subsequent to this, Marc discovered he had fathered twin children by an old girlfriend from Japan, when one of them, Jodi, tracked him down when her mother died. Like her father, Jodi's alien genes gave her superhuman powers, and she took the identity of Crimson so she could adventure with him. Backlash and Taboo arranged a pardon for their crimes in return for working for America's Department of Paranormal Science Investigations (Department PSI). It was around this point Marc finally learned of his Kherubim ancestry - for reasons best known to himself, Ferrian had never told Marc. Marc was placed in charge of forming a team of superpowered operatives for them, codenamed Wildcore. He worked with this new team until most of them were killed trying to stop a breakout at the Purgatory Max facility. Marc survived thanks to the assistance of former DV8 member Evo who had been imprisoned for the murder of an N.Y.P.D. officer. Marc lost a leg, which has yet to heal (if it ever will).

I.O.
Marc Slayton is now working for Internal Operations (fromerly International Operations) again, his missing limb replaced with a bionic one. In the events surrounding Holden Carver and Tao's criminal Syndicate, Slayton was seen working alongside his former Team 7 teammate John Lynch.

Worldstorm
In the wake of the Worldstorm, Slayton seems to have risen to the level of Deputy Director while Lynch has become an I.O. Commander.

World's End

When the events of Number of the Beast occurred, Slayton was deep underground within Internal Operations Research and Containment Facility #42 in New Mexico. As the only survivor, he fought his way out and received a message from John Lynch for Team 7 to reassemble.


Alternate Versions:
  • Alternative 838: In this gender-reversed universe, a female Backlash was recruited by the Midnighter to fight the Renegade Doctor and was killed.
  • The Bleed Universe: Backlash is a member of StormWatch under Weatherman Jack Hawksmoor's command.

Trivia:
  • Backlash was created by Brett Booth & Jim Lee
  • Originally, Backlash was going to be a vampire, thus his ability to turn into mist.
